Hello, I just received a Linconln Precision TIG 185 (free) today, along with a few toungstens, and some aluminum filler rod.I have the machine set up in AC, 35 amps, 3/32nd filler and toungsten (green), as shown by my slide rule.  the material is a very light guage aluminum sheet.The arc is not stable, and doesn't seem to melt the material, but will melt the filler rod.  The melted rod sits on top of the aluminum, similar to dripping solder onto a cold steel plate.Three specific questions1) How much stick out should the toungsten have from the edge of the cup2) what sort of tip should I be grinding3) what are the average canadian costs of toungstens?
Reply:I bet your aluminum workpiece needs to be cleaned more.  Scrub it in one direction with a stainless brush and see if that helps.  It should be bright and shiney.  Make sure you have the angles right with the torch and filler.  Try to make a puddle before you add filler, and when the puddle forms add the filler at a very low angle to get under the reflected heat.  35 amps sounds a little weak, you might also pump up the amps a bit and the arc might stabilize, but that all depends on just how thick the workpiece is.  I have read some posts that complain about the arc stability on this machine...you might check into that if the stuff above doesnt work.Smithboy...if it ain't broke, you ain't tryin'.
Reply:So, i tryed cleaning, no avail.  Now, I don't think I changed any settings, but i've started burning through toungsten like crazy.  What could this mean.I also tryed the reverse polarity on aluminum, but I just tripped the breaker, even at 5a. hmmm...?
Reply:If your tungsten touched the surface of the aluminum you may have really contaminated it.  Regrind it to a point.  If you are running DC you shouldnt be.  AC with high frequency on continuous is the way to go.  Post a picture of the settings, there might be something obvious that I am not thinking of right now.Smithboy...if it ain't broke, you ain't tryin'.
